Event Description

With different tax rates for individuals and trusts, tax planning takes on more importance. New legislation increases the importance of generating new ideas for financial planning and saving for retirement. The purpose of this course is to explore practical tax-planning ideas that practitioners can use to assist clients with their needs. This course is crucial for CPAs who are looking for good ideas that can save clients money! Continually updated for legislative developments.

Designed For

All Accounting and Finance Professionals, especially those who want to provide the best up-to-the-minute tax advice

Objectives

Understand life insurance for both income and estate planning     Identify strategies that are effective following estate and gift tax reform     Understand options available to baby boomers as they reach retirement in light of Social Security     Prepare for potential legislative changes to retirement and estate planning

Major Subjects

Comprehensive coverage of the Inflation Reduction Act and the SECURE Act 2.0     Timely coverage of breaking tax legislation     Changes to the lifetime estate tax exemption in light of proposed regulations     Considerations when selling a principal residence     Tax benefits of HSAs     An overview of the mechanics and practical considerations of Donor Advised Funds     A historical overview of virtual currency as well as increased IRS scrutiny on the tax implications of such transactions     The best new income tax and estate-planning ideas     The changing Social Security landscape: what it means for planning     Creative charitable giving strategies     Financial planning strategies     Maximizing retirement plan benefits     Using intentionally defective grantor trusts     Miscellaneous tax-planning techniques that can add up to significant tax savings     How to use the whole family for tax savings     Life insurance     Up-to-the-minute ideas reflecting new tax law changes in cases, regulations, and rulings

Prerequisites

Basic course in individual income tax, Social Security, and estate planning
